Opengl gui from scratch
Web8 de fev. de 2024 · Rust and OpenGL from scratch - Window. Feb 8, 2024. Welcome back! Previously, we got some motivation to use Rust and configured our development environment. In this lesson, we will create a window! If that does not sound too exciting, we will also learn about Rust libraries. Very exciting. Web27 de jun. de 2011 · Create a simple GUI from scratch. On a platform that has no real libraries available, and bare-minimum graphics other than a "display object of dimension …
Opengl gui from scratch
Did you know?
Web2 de jun. de 2024 · The Blender GUI is established through an interplay of multiple parts of the code. I.e. on a high level: GHOST – OS dependent code (windows, OpenGL context, device input, etc.) Window-Manager – OS independent management of windows, events, keymaps, data-change notifiers, etc. Web27 de jun. de 2016 · For those of you who don't know what OpenGL is, it's a plug-in used to make 3-dimensional graphics, simulations, and more. It would actually be pretty neat to have some OpenGL functions in Scratch, but there are some drawbacks: 1. Scratch runs on Flash, which isn't in general the best platform to run OpenGL on. 2.
WebopenGL下, 构建渲染节点树作为基础自然就可以。 引擎本身就是高于且细于普通GUI的实时渲染框架。 引擎架构当然理应很好地包含了这些低响应度的二维精灵,也就是UI。 发布于 2024-04-25 14:39 赞同 添加评论 分享 收藏 喜欢 收起 haroel 技术 管理 生活 关注 推荐去看看 skia,skia是Android 和Chrome的默认UI引擎,底层依据特定平台有基于opengl … WebI wrote a few minimal game-engines, a variety of tools, a general purpose GUI system from scratch in OpenGL, a simple computer emulator (CHIP-8/SCHIP), a framework for writing 3D model loaders as ...
WebC++ OpenGL GUI SmokyTurbo 16 subscribers Subscribe 102 Share 14K views 10 years ago A quick demo of a simple GUI framework, coded from scratch in C++ and OpenGL. … Web10 de dez. de 2024 · 基于 函数调用 动态生成UI tree. 布局计算是个问题。. 还有如果不做好跨帧的组件更新缓存,意味着每个UI事件都要刷新所有UI布局。. 布局模型:. 参考dom的盒模型,多种布局relative flex absolute 叠加上margin padding 再叠加 overflow/scroll 如果是immediate mode这一切都基于 ...
Web21 de dez. de 2016 · for “modern OpenGL” you have to: put your data into buffer objects (VBO) (or texture objects) tell OpenGL how to read those buffers, therefore you need vertex array objects (VAO) to draw the bunch of data, you need a program object (which is made up by at least 2 shaders: vertex / fragment)
Web6 de mar. de 2007 · PyOpenGL 3.x (currently in alpha state, but reasonably usable) works on Python 2.5, there are no binaries because the system no longer requires binary versions. Install the setuptools package, then run easy_install PyOpenGL and the egg file should be downloaded and installed to your machine. simple menu themesWeb29 de nov. de 2024 · The easiest way to have UI with openGL is to use ImGui GitHub - ocornut/imgui: Dear ImGui: Bloat-free Graphical User interface for C++ with minimal … raw vegan healthyWeb25 de dez. de 2024 · Opengl Gui From Scratch OpenGL is a powerful graphics library that can be used to create sophisticated GUIs. However, creating an OpenGL GUI from … raw vegan healingWebSummary : 🤩 My goal is (directly) to create great products and (indirectly) the satisfaction of my customers 💻 My (best) skill is to develop custom software more user-friendly and more eco-friendly oriented 🚀 Finally, as a freelancer, I leverage my (rare) experience to Hardware and Software companies 📚 To improve myself, I also enjoy reading … simple men\u0027s clothing styleWebLogging can be per-frame or continuous. The plugin system provided also allows real-time editing of shaders and manipulation of OpenGL states. KTX is a lightweight file format … raw vegan groceryWebUI : User Interface. Any type of interface that will allow a human to interact with a machine, there can be many types of User Interfaces, one of the most easiest of classification of … raw vegan hummus recipeWebFirst of all we need to initialize a widget, which can be done in constructor, but I've chosen to use Initialize () function. to do it. The idea is to have a re-usable widget that can be … raw vegan holiday recipes